1. Start With the Outcome, Not the Stall
One of the most common mistakes exhibitors make is beginning with the question:
“What should our stall look like?”
A better question is:
“What should this exhibition achieve for our business?”
Before planning your next exhibition in Bangalore, define your primary objective.
Are you looking to generate qualified leads? Launch a new product? Meet architects, developers or distributors? Strengthen relationships with existing clients? Enter a new market? Or simply make your brand more visible among key industry decision-makers?
Your objective should influence almost everything that follows—from the size and layout of the stall to meeting areas, product displays, technology and visitor engagement.
A stall designed primarily for lead generation, for example, needs a different visitor journey from one created for high-level client meetings.
Start with the business objective. Let the design follow.
2. Choose the Right Exhibition for Your Audience
Not every exhibition deserves a place in your annual marketing calendar.
Bangalore hosts numerous B2B exhibitions across architecture, construction, technology, manufacturing, interiors and other industries. The smartest exhibitors evaluate trade shows in bangalore based on the quality of the audience rather than simply the number of visitors.
Before participating, study the event’s visitor profile, previous exhibitors, industry relevance and potential decision-makers attending the show.
Events such as acetech bangalore, for instance, attract businesses operating across architecture, building materials, construction, design and allied sectors.
The important question is not:
“How big is the exhibition?”
It is:
“Are the people we want to meet going to be there?”
That distinction can make a significant difference to your return on investment.
3. Preparing for an Exhibition in Bangalore? Start Early
A successful exhibition rarely comes together at the last minute.
Once your participation is confirmed, create a reverse timeline from the opening day. Break the project into clear stages covering concept development, stall design, approvals, fabrication, graphics, product displays, audiovisual requirements, logistics and on-site execution.
Early planning also gives your design team more room to explore ideas rather than simply racing against deadlines.
For a major exhibition in Bangalore, your preparation should ideally bring marketing, sales, design and execution teams onto the same page from the beginning.
The exhibition stall should not be treated as an isolated construction project. It is a physical extension of your brand campaign.
4. Design for the Three-Second Decision
Picture yourself walking through a busy exhibition hall.
There are lights, screens, products, graphics and conversations everywhere. Dozens of brands are competing for your attention.
How long do you spend deciding whether to enter a particular stall?
Probably only a few seconds.
That is why exhibition design needs visual hierarchy.
Your brand identity should be visible from a distance. Your key message should be easy to understand. And your most important product or proposition should not be buried under excessive graphics.
At an exhibition in Bangalore, where several established and emerging brands may be competing within the same category, visual clarity can be more powerful than visual clutter.
Instead of trying to say everything, decide what you want visitors to remember after they walk away.
One strong message usually works harder than ten competing ones.
5. Design Around the Visitor Journey
A beautiful stall is valuable. A beautiful stall that also guides visitors naturally towards a business conversation is far more valuable.
Before your next exhibition in Bangalore, map the experience from the visitor’s perspective.
What will they notice first? Where will they enter? What will encourage them to stop? Where will products be displayed? Where will your team initiate conversations? Where can serious prospects sit down for a detailed discussion?
The answers should influence your floor plan.
Open layouts can make the stall more approachable, while strategically positioned meeting spaces provide privacy without disconnecting visitors from the overall experience.
The objective is to eliminate friction.
A visitor should never have to wonder where to go or whom to speak to.
6. Make Your Stall Interactive—But With Purpose
Technology has become an integral part of modern exhibitions, but adding a screen simply because everyone else has one rarely creates meaningful engagement.
Interactive elements should serve a purpose.
At your exhibition in Bangalore, you could use touchscreens to simplify complex product portfolios, large-format displays for brand films, digital catalogues to reduce printed collateral, or interactive product demonstrations to help visitors understand your offering.
Physical experiences can be equally effective.
Material libraries, working models, live demonstrations and hands-on product zones can turn passive visitors into active participants.
The principle is simple:
Don’t use technology to decorate the stall. Use it to deepen the conversation.
7. Prepare Your Sales Team as Carefully as Your Stall
An exceptional stall can bring people in. Your team determines what happens next.
Before participating in trade shows in bangalore, brief everyone representing your company on the exhibition objective, priority customer profiles, new products, key talking points and lead qualification process.
Avoid having team members simply stand around waiting for visitors to ask questions.
They should know how to initiate conversations naturally and, equally importantly, recognise when a casual visitor has become a serious prospect.
For an important exhibition in Bangalore, consider categorising leads into groups such as immediate opportunities, high-potential prospects, existing clients and long-term opportunities.
That makes post-show follow-up significantly more focused.
8. Promote Your Presence Before the Exhibition Opens
Your exhibition marketing should begin before the exhibition itself.
Tell existing customers, prospects, partners and your digital audience where they can find you.
Use email campaigns, LinkedIn, social media, WhatsApp communication and your sales team’s individual networks to build anticipation.
Instead of simply posting:
“Visit us at Stall A12.”
Give people a reason to visit.
Perhaps you are unveiling a new product, showcasing an installation, demonstrating new technology or offering one-to-one consultations with your team.

9. Capture Leads While the Conversation Is Fresh
Collecting hundreds of business cards may look impressive at the end of an exhibition, but volume alone means very little.
What matters is context.
For every meaningful conversation at your exhibition in Bangalore, capture information such as the visitor’s company, requirement, decision-making role, project stage, expected timeline and agreed next action.
Digital lead capture systems can make this process considerably easier.
More importantly, record a short note immediately after the conversation.
Three days later, “Mr Sharma – interested” may tell your sales team almost nothing.
“Mr Sharma – upcoming commercial project – needs product presentation next week” gives them something they can act on.
10. Your Exhibition Isn’t Over When the Stall Comes Down
The exhibition floor may close in the evening, but your real opportunity is only beginning.
Follow-up is where exhibition investment starts turning into business.
After an exhibition in Bangalore, divide leads according to intent and urgency. High-value opportunities should receive personalised communication rather than a generic “Thank you for visiting our stall” email.
Reference the conversation. Share the information requested. Schedule the next discussion.
Then measure performance.
Look beyond footfall and evaluate qualified leads, meetings, proposals generated, opportunities created and eventually conversions.
These metrics help determine which exhibitions deserve greater investment in the future.
